Would this be a good alt to the BPV? Would just limiting max boost be sufficient?
______________________________________
Manual Boost Controller
For 240, 700 and 900 Turbos
This boost controller mounts in line between the intake manifold and the wastegate. The controller holds the manifold signal in check until the desired boost level is reached. Delaying the boost signal decreases boost lag for an increase in lower rpm performance. It can also be used as a more accessible boost level adjustment device.
This is a completely mechanical device at hundreds of dollars less than electronic boost controllers. Simple installation is well under an hour and no wiring. We recommend the use of a boost gauge and some form of mixture monitoring device when increasing boost. See air fuel ratio meter on previous page.
